JACKSONVILLE, Fla. -- A student minister at a church in Mandarin is facing charges of child molestation.

Police arrested David Wayne Lawson, 38, on four counts of lewd and lascivious molestation on a victim older than 12 but under the age of 16.

The police report shows the victim is 15.

The investigation began in December of last year when police received a report about a man engaged in sexual activity with a minor.

Police received new evidence this week that corroborated the initial report.

On Wednesday, police went to Christ's Church on Greenland Road where Lawson works as a student minister.

Officers detained him for questioning. He reportedly confessed and was taken to jail.

Police say Lawson expressed suicidal thoughts as a result of his arrest.

Lawson is being held at the Duval County Jail without bond.

He's been fired from the church.
